|  | 
	                
  
    | 
	 
        ผม query ข้อมูลจากไฟล์ php เป็น JSON ช่วยเขียนโค้ด รับและปักหมุด google map ให้หน่อย ครับ     |  
    |  |  
 
              
  
    | 
 
        
          |  |  |  |  |  
          |  |  | 
            
              | Code (PHP) 
 				$objConnect = mysql_connect("localhost","root","") or die(mysql_error());
				$objDB = mysql_select_db("mydatabase");
				$strSQL = "SELECT * FROM customer WHERE 1 AND CountryCode like '%".$strCountry."%' ";
				$objQuery = mysql_query($strSQL) or die (mysql_error());
				$intNumField = mysql_num_fields($objQuery);
				$resultArray = array();
				while($obResult = mysql_fetch_array($objQuery))
				{
					$arrCol = array();
					for($i=0;$i<$intNumField;$i++)
					{
						$arrCol[mysql_field_name($objQuery,$i)] = $obResult[$i];
					}
					array_push($resultArray,$arrCol);
				}
				
				echo json_encode($resultArray);
 |  
              | 
                
                  |  |  |  |  
                  |  | 
                      
                        | Date :
                            2012-08-17 14:06:06 | By :
                            mr.win |  |  |  
                  |  |  |  |  |  |  |  
          |  |  |  |  |  
 
        
          |  |  |  |  |  
          |  |  | 
            
              | อยากได้ฝั่งรับอ่ะ ครับ 
 |  
              | 
                
                  |  |  |  |  
                  |  | 
                      
                        | Date :
                            2012-08-17 19:58:51 | By :
                            phuwanart |  |  |  
                  |  |  |  |  |  |  |  
          |  |  |  |  |  
 
        
          |  |  |  |  |  
          |  |  | 
            
              | ฝั่งที่เป็น jquery รับข้อมูลเป็น JSON อ่ะ คับ ขอบคุญคับ 
 |  
              | 
                
                  |  |  |  |  
                  |  | 
                      
                        | Date :
                            2012-08-18 14:21:04 | By :
                            phuwanart |  |  |  
                  |  |  |  |  |  |  |  
          |  |  |  |  |  
 
        
          |  |  |  |  |  
          |  |  | 
            
              | ใช้  jQuery.parseJSON(result); ครับ 
 Code (jQuery)
 
 
<script type="text/javascript">
$(document).ready(function(){
	$("#btn1").click(function(){
			$.ajax({ 
				url: "WebServiceClient.php" ,
				type: "POST",
				data: 'keyword=' +$("#txtCountryCode").val()
			})
			.success(function(result) { 
					$("#div1").empty();
				var obj = jQuery.parseJSON(result);
				  $.each(obj, function(key, val) {
					   $("#div1").append('<hr />');
					   $("#div1").append('[' + key + '] ' + 'CustomerID=' + val["CustomerID"] +'<br />');
					   $("#div1").append('[' + key + '] ' + 'Name=' + val["Name"] +'<br />');
					   $("#div1").append('[' + key + '] ' + 'Email=' + val["Email"] +'<br />');
					   $("#div1").append('[' + key + '] ' + 'CountryCode=' + val["CountryCode"] +'<br />');
					   $("#div1").append('[' + key + '] ' + 'Budget=' + val["Budget"] +'<br />');
					   $("#div1").append('[' + key + '] ' + 'Used=' + val["Used"] +'<br />');
				  });
			});
		});
	});
</script>
 Go to : jQuery Ajax กับ JSON (Web Service) ทำความเข้าใจ การรับส่งข้อมูล JSON ผ่าน jQuery กับ Ajax
 
 |  
              | 
                
                  |  |  |  |  
                  |  | 
                      
                        | Date :
                            2012-08-19 09:11:33 | By :
                            mr.win |  |  |  
                  |  |  |  |  |  |  |  
          |  |  |  |  |  
 
        
          |  |  |  |  |  
          |  |  | 
            
              | ขอบคุณ ครับพี่ 
 |  
              | 
                
                  |  |  |  |  
                  |  | 
                      
                        | Date :
                            2012-08-20 13:26:43 | By :
                            phuwanart |  |  |  
                  |  |  |  |  |  |  |  
          |  |  |  |  |  |  |